Where AI Can Help Your Business

AI is most useful when it is tied to real work your team already does every day.

Sales

Help customers choose the right product, qualify leads, follow up with prospects, and give your team better information before the sale.

Customer Service

Answer common questions, summarize customer issues, help staff respond faster, and reduce repetitive support work.

Operations

Automate repetitive tasks, generate summaries, organize information, and reduce manual work across your business.

Reporting and Financial Planning

Turn spreadsheets, P&L statements, Balance Sheets, and business records into clearer insights, projections, and planning documents.

Internal Knowledge

Give your team an AI assistant that can answer questions using your company’s own documents, policies, procedures, and training materials.

Management Decisions

Help owners and managers see trends, compare actual performance to projections, and make better decisions with the information they already have.

A Simple Path to Practical AI

We make AI adoption manageable, even if your business has never built software before.

You do not need to know exactly what to build. We help you start small, prove value, and expand only when it makes sense.

01

Understand

We learn how your business works, what tools you already use, where your team spends time, and what problems are worth solving.

02

Prioritize

We identify the AI opportunities with the best mix of business value, speed, affordability, and ease of adoption.

03

Build or Integrate

We either build a custom tool or connect proven AI technology to your existing systems.

04

Train and Launch

We help your team use the tool confidently, understand what AI can and cannot do, and make sure it fits into daily operations.

05

Improve

Once the tool is live, we review performance, gather feedback, compare results, and improve it over time.
